The two girls and one boy were last seen at the school about 12.15pm on Thursday.
The girls are aged 11 and nine years old; the boy is 10 years old.
Police said the three children were known to deliberately hide and believe they are still in the Tuggeranong area.
At the time, police said they were still concerned about their wellbeing considering the temperature will drop at sunset.
Police thanked Canberrans for their help.
